Evaporator Tube: Service and Repair

EVAPORATOR TUBE

Removal Procedure

CAUTION:  Refer to Battery Disconnect Caution in Cautions and notes.

1. Disconnect the battery negative cable.

2. Recover the refrigerant from the system. Refer to Refrigerant Recovery and Recharging.
3. Remove the evaporator tube clip screw.
4. Remove the evaporator tube clip from the accumulator.
5. Remove the evaporator tube from the evaporator.

6. Remove the O-ring seat.
7. Remove the evaporator tube from the condenser.
8. Remove the O-ring seal.
